Output d621acf69fa6a0e0c81006bb1fdbfd0709a2e091d03ad8fa8362fe6a67c38413:2

value
14225056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36cf7f282cab7f268fadb981adf2c20f77e6ac4e OP_EQUAL
address
36gpz2VWHqXyw762FhdBMHC1CZR6MUaBHf
transaction
d621acf69fa6a0e0c81006bb1fdbfd0709a2e091d03ad8fa8362fe6a67c38413
spent
true